- [ ] Step 7: Archive cold storage buckets (Glacierline tier). Confirm both ceremony witnesses are present, verify bucket manifests match the Oxbow ledger, then seal the archive key shares. Plugin authors may observe but not handle shares. Once sealed, the archive index itself is encrypted and can only be reopened with the passphrase below.

vault phrase of badup-hahig = tamael-aldael-kelmir-istael-fenok-istwyn-tamius-jorath-oliion

Visitors must not be taken into the evacuation-chair store on Level 4 of Ashgrove Court unless accompanied by a trained warden. Team assistants arranging warden refresher sessions for the Quillon project should book the room through the facilities calendar and confirm the chair inventory before and after each session. The store must remain locked at all times, and any missing equipment reported immediately. Assistants escorting trainers should use the door code noted below.

staff pass of bajop-tagep = bdg-QIJEL-2

Subject: DR drill — Thursday

On-call: Thursday's drill simulates loss of the Corvane encoding-detection service. Uploaded text files will fall back to raw bytes; expect garbled previews in the Hollis dashboard. Your job: fail over to the standby detector in the Ridgemoor cluster and confirm UTF-8 sniffing resumes within 15 minutes. No customer comms needed. The standby's recovery vault unlocks with the passphrase below.

recovery phrase for bajef-yagag: zordor-casok-tammir

### Account Recovery — Catalogue Import (Lintwood)

Quick one for review: when the Lintwood catalogue import wipes a patron's session table, the recovery flow re-seeds accounts from the nightly snapshot. Check that the importer skips locked accounts — last time it didn't. To rerun recovery against staging you'll need the vault passphrase, which is appended just below.

recovery phrase for yafof-tajof: julmir-kelax-julvan-holath-belvan-holir-ralael-ralvan-ralath-julvan-silmir-istmir-kaswyn-ulamir